My dog's eye is cut and bleeding. How do I treat it at home?
Cleanse the wound with warm water or saline solution. You can either flush the wound (being careful to avoid the eye) or wipe the cut with a moistened gauze pad. Pat dry. Apply a thin film of a triple antibiotic ointment (such as Neosporin) twice daily. Monitor the wound for swelling, redness, or discharge. If you notice these signs, then you will need to have the wound looked at by your veterinarian. Most importantly, make sure your dog's rabies vaccination is up-to-date. If you are unsure or close to the due date, contact your veterinarian. Place an e-collar (cone) on him or her to prevent pawing, rubbing or scratching.
